Foundation Overview
Based in Rankin, IL, Wheeler Foundation has awarded 97 grants totaling $8,155,434 to organizations in Illinois and Indiana. Individual grants range from $199 to $748,000, with a median award of $28,185.

Geographic Focus
95% of all grants are concentrated in Illinois,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Illinois, funding concentrates in Danville (20%), Hoopeston (12%), Normal (9%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
